수술 분야 인공지능(AI) 및 분석 세계 시장, 2030년까지 9억 5,080만 달러에 달할 전망
2024년에 2억 5,530만 달러로 추정되는 수술 분야 인공지능(AI) 및 분석 세계 시장은 2024-2030년간 24.5%의 연평균 복합 성장률(CAGR)로 성장하여 2030년에는 9억 5,080만 달러에 달할 것으로 예상됩니다. 본 보고서에서 분석한 부문 중 하나인 소프트웨어 부문은 CAGR 21.5%를 기록하여 분석 기간 종료 시점에 5억 1,320만 달러에 달할 것으로 예측됩니다. 서비스 분야의 성장률은 분석 기간 동안 CAGR 28.9%로 추정됩니다.
미국 시장 6,710만 달러로 추정, 중국은 CAGR 23.4%로 성장 전망
미국의 수술 인공지능(AI) 및 분석 시장 규모는 2024년 6,710만 달러로 추정됩니다. 세계 2위의 경제 대국인 중국은 2030년까지 1억 4,580만 달러 규모에 도달할 것으로 예상되며, 2024-2030년의 분석 기간 동안 23.4%의 연평균 복합 성장률(CAGR)을 나타낼 전망입니다. 다른 주목할 만한 지역 시장으로는 일본과 캐나다가 분석 기간 동안 각각 21.9%와 21.4%의 연평균 복합 성장률(CAGR)을 나타낼 전망입니다. 유럽에서는 독일이 약 17.2%의 연평균 복합 성장률(CAGR)로 성장할 것으로 예상됩니다.
세계 수술 분야 인공지능(AI) 및 분석 시장 - 주요 동향 및 촉진요인 요약
AI와 애널리틱스가 외과 수술을 어떻게 변화시킬 것인가?
인공지능(AI)과 애널리틱스는 외과 수술 분야에 혁명을 일으키고 있으며, 수술의 정확성, 효율성, 안전성을 향상시키고 있습니다. AI 알고리즘은 복잡한 환자 데이터를 분석하여 수술 전, 수술 중, 수술 후 의사들이 정보에 입각한 결정을 내릴 수 있도록 돕고 있으며, AI 기반 시스템이 상세한 시뮬레이션과 예측 모델을 제공하여 수술 접근법을 최적화하기 때문에 수술 전 계획이 크게 발전하고 있습니다. 수술 전 계획이 크게 발전하고 있습니다. 이러한 도구는 개인별 필요에 따라 절차를 조정하여 실수를 줄이고 환자 결과를 개선합니다.
수술 중 AI 기반 로봇 시스템과 실시간 분석은 시각화 및 안내를 강화하여 외과의사에게 도움을 줍니다. 예를 들어, AI 기반 카메라와 영상 시스템은 중요한 해부학적 구조를 식별하여 수술 침습을 최소화하고 합병증 발생 가능성을 줄일 수 있습니다. 또한 예측 분석은 출혈 및 합병증 발생 가능성과 같은 문제를 예측하는 데 사용되어 수술실에서 더 나은 준비와 빠른 대응 시간을 보장합니다. 이러한 기술 혁신은 현대 수술의 정확성과 신뢰성에 대한 새로운 기준을 제시하고 있습니다.
수술에서 AI와 애널리틱스의 도입을 촉진하는 요인은 무엇일까?
수술에 AI와 애널리틱스의 도입이 확대되고 있는 배경에는 기술의 발전과 환자 결과 개선에 대한 요구가 증가하고 있으며, AI 지원 수술 로봇이 더욱 정교해져 회복 시간을 단축하고 입원 기간을 단축하는 최소 침습적 시술을 가능하게 하고 있습니다. 이러한 시스템은 첨단 영상 기술과 원활하게 통합되어 외과 의사에게 수술 부위를 종합적으로 볼 수 있는 시야를 제공합니다. 이는 특히 신경외과나 종양학과 같은 복잡한 수술에서 정확성이 중요한 의미를 갖는다.
가치 기반 의료로의 전환도 큰 원동력이 되고 있습니다. 병원과 수술센터는 의료의 질을 떨어뜨리지 않으면서 효율성을 개선하고 비용을 절감해야 하는데, AI와 애널리틱스는 자원 배분을 최적화하고 워크플로우를 간소화하며 수술팀의 협업을 강화하는 데 도움이 될 수 있습니다. 또한, 자연어 처리와 음성인식 시스템의 발전은 문서화 과정을 간소화하여 외과의사가 환자 치료에 더 집중할 수 있도록 돕습니다. 이러한 요인들이 종합적으로 작용하여 현대 수술 환경의 요구 사항을 충족하기 위해 AI와 분석에 대한 의존도가 높아지고 있다는 것을 뒷받침합니다.
AI와 애널리틱스가 수술 후 관리 문제를 해결할 수 있을까?
수술 후 관리는 수술의 성공에 필수적인 측면이며, AI는 이 단계에서 점점 더 중요한 역할을 하고 있으며, AI 기반 예측 모델은 환자 데이터를 분석하여 회복 궤적을 예측하고 감염 및 합병증과 같은 잠재적 위험을 식별할 수 있도록 도와줍니다. AI 기반 모니터링 시스템은 환자의 활력 징후를 원격으로 추적하고 임상의에게 실시간 최신 정보를 제공하여 이상 징후를 조기에 발견할 수 있게 해주고, AI 기반 모니터링 시스템은 환자의 활력 징후를 원격으로 추적하고 임상의에게 실시간 최신 정보를 제공하여 이상 징후를 조기에 발견할 수 있게 해줍니다.
분석은 환자 참여와 수술 후 관리 계획 준수율을 높이는 데도 도움이 됩니다. 의료 서비스 제공업체는 환자별 데이터를 기반으로 회복을 위한 개인화된 조언을 제공함으로써 더 나은 순응도와 빠른 회복을 보장할 수 있습니다. 또한 AI는 과거 수술의 대규모 데이터 세트를 분석하여 수술 후 프로토콜의 증거 기반 개선에 도움이 되는 트렌드와 모범 사례를 식별하는 데 사용되고 있습니다. 이러한 기술은 회복 경험을 향상시킬 뿐만 아니라 외과 의료 표준을 광범위하게 개선하는 데에도 기여하고 있습니다.
수술 분야에서 AI와 애널리틱스의 성장 원동력은?
수술 분야의 인공지능(AI) 및 분석 시장의 성장은 몇 가지 주요 요인에 의해 이루어지고 있으며, 이는 수술 진료에 이러한 기술이 점점 더 많이 통합되고 있다는 것을 반영하고 있습니다. 효과적인 외과적 개입을 가능하게 하고 있습니다. 암, 심혈관 질환과 같은 복잡한 질환의 유병률 증가도 AI와 분석이 수술 결과를 개선하는 데 매우 중요한 역할을 하는 첨단 수술 솔루션에 대한 수요를 촉진하고 있습니다.
개인화된 최소침습 수술에 대한 소비자의 기대가 높아지면서 의료 서비스 제공업체들은 AI를 활용한 수술 전 계획 도구와 로봇 보조 시스템을 통해 정확도를 높이고 회복 시간을 단축하는 등 첨단 기술을 도입하고 있습니다. 또한, 데이터 기반 의료에 대한 관심이 높아지고 환자 안전에 대한 규제 요건이 강화됨에 따라 수술 워크플로우에 분석이 통합되고 있습니다. 이러한 기술들은 업무 효율성을 높이고, 환자 치료를 강화하며, 헬스케어 분야의 변화하는 요구에 대응하는 데 필수적인 요소로 자리 잡았습니다. 기술 혁신이 진행됨에 따라 AI와 분석은 외과 수술의 미래를 형성하는 데 있어 더욱 중요한 역할을 하게 될 것입니다.

Global Artificial Intelligence and Analytics in Surgery Market to Reach US$950.8 Million by 2030
The global market for Artificial Intelligence and Analytics in Surgery estimated at US$255.3 Million in the year 2024, is expected to reach US$950.8 Million by 2030, growing at a CAGR of 24.5% over the analysis period 2024-2030. Software Component, one of the segments analyzed in the report, is expected to record a 21.5% CAGR and reach US$513.2 Million by the end of the analysis period. Growth in the Services Component segment is estimated at 28.9% CAGR over the analysis period.
The U.S. Market is Estimated at US$67.1 Million While China is Forecast to Grow at 23.4% CAGR
The Artificial Intelligence and Analytics in Surgery market in the U.S. is estimated at US$67.1 Million in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$145.8 Million by the year 2030 trailing a CAGR of 23.4%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 21.9% and 21.4%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 17.2% CAGR.
Global Artificial Intelligence and Analytics in Surgery Market - Key Trends & Drivers Summarized
How Are AI and Analytics Transforming Surgical Procedures?
Artificial Intelligence (AI) and analytics are revolutionizing the field of surgery, making procedures more precise, efficient, and safer. Advanced AI algorithms are being employed to analyze complex patient data, enabling surgeons to make well-informed decisions before, during, and after surgeries. Preoperative planning has seen significant advancements, as AI-powered systems provide detailed simulations and predictive models to optimize surgical approaches. These tools reduce errors and enhance patient outcomes by tailoring procedures to individual needs.
During surgeries, AI-driven robotic systems and real-time analytics assist surgeons by providing enhanced visualization and guidance. For example, AI-powered cameras and imaging systems can identify critical anatomical structures, minimize surgical invasiveness, and reduce the likelihood of complications. Additionally, predictive analytics is being used to anticipate challenges such as blood loss or potential complications, ensuring better preparedness and quicker response times in the operating room. These innovations are setting new standards for precision and reliability in modern surgery.
What Is Driving AI and Analytics Adoption in Surgery?
The growing adoption of AI and analytics in surgery is fueled by advancements in technology and an increasing demand for improved patient outcomes. AI-enabled surgical robots are becoming more sophisticated, allowing for minimally invasive procedures that result in shorter recovery times and reduced hospital stays. These systems integrate seamlessly with advanced imaging technologies, providing surgeons with a comprehensive view of the surgical field. This is particularly valuable in complex surgeries such as neurosurgery and oncology, where precision is critical.
The shift toward value-based healthcare is also a significant driver. Hospitals and surgical centers are under pressure to improve efficiency and reduce costs without compromising care quality. AI and analytics help optimize resource allocation, streamline workflows, and enhance surgical team coordination. Furthermore, advancements in natural language processing and voice-activated systems are simplifying documentation processes, enabling surgeons to focus more on patient care. These factors collectively underscore the growing reliance on AI and analytics to meet the demands of modern surgical environments.
Can AI and Analytics Address Challenges in Postoperative Care?
Postoperative care is a critical aspect of surgical success, and AI is playing an increasingly vital role in this phase. AI-driven predictive models analyze patient data to forecast recovery trajectories and identify potential risks, such as infections or complications. This allows healthcare providers to intervene proactively, reducing readmission rates and improving long-term outcomes. AI-powered monitoring systems can track patients’ vital signs remotely, providing real-time updates to clinicians and enabling early detection of any abnormalities.
Analytics also contribute to improving patient engagement and adherence to postoperative care plans. By personalizing recovery recommendations based on patient-specific data, healthcare providers can ensure better compliance and quicker recoveries. Additionally, AI is being used to analyze large datasets from past surgeries, identifying trends and best practices that inform evidence-based improvements in postoperative protocols. These technologies are not only enhancing recovery experiences but also contributing to broader improvements in surgical care standards.
What’s Driving the Growth of AI and Analytics in Surgery?
The growth in the Artificial Intelligence and Analytics in Surgery market is driven by several key factors, reflecting the increasing integration of these technologies into surgical practices. Rapid advancements in AI algorithms, coupled with the availability of high-resolution imaging and real-time analytics, are enabling more precise and effective surgical interventions. The rising prevalence of complex diseases such as cancer and cardiovascular disorders is also driving demand for advanced surgical solutions, where AI and analytics play a pivotal role in improving outcomes.
Consumer expectations for personalized and minimally invasive procedures are pushing healthcare providers to adopt cutting-edge technologies. AI-driven preoperative planning tools and robotic assistance systems are meeting these demands by enhancing precision and reducing recovery times. Furthermore, the growing emphasis on data-driven healthcare and regulatory requirements for patient safety are encouraging the integration of analytics into surgical workflows. These technologies are proving indispensable for improving operational efficiency, enhancing patient care, and addressing the evolving needs of the healthcare sector. As innovation continues to advance, AI and analytics are poised to play an even greater role in shaping the future of surgery.
